Harry G. Frankfurt is a renowned American philosopher best known for his influential work on the nature of free will, moral responsibility, and the philosophy of language. Born in Germany and later emigrating to the United States, Frankfurt has spent much of his academic career exploring complex philosophical concepts. His most famous essay, "On Bullshit," delves into the nature of insincerity and the importance of truth, earning him widespread recognition beyond academic circles. Frankfurt's thought-provoking ideas challenge readers to consider the implications of language and honesty in everyday life.
Throughout his career, Frankfurt has held various teaching positions at prestigious institutions, contributing significantly to the field of philosophy. His work is characterized by a clear, accessible writing style that invites engagement from both scholars and lay readers alike. Frankfurt's exploration of the intricacies of human behavior and ethics continues to influence contemporary debates in philosophy and beyond, making him a vital figure in understanding the complexities of human thought and action.
